Nimble Web Search Agents cut AI research token costs by 51%

Key takeaway

  • Nimble today launched Web Search Agents, a specialized web research tool that adapts to each customer's domain rather than returning generic results, reducing token consumption by 51% per query while improving answer quality by 21 points.

  • The product targets enterprises running long-running AI agents for business-critical research, where accuracy and cost efficiency matter more than speed.

  • It is available immediately through multiple developer interfaces with a free trial.

Context & Analysis

Nimble's Web Search Agents addresses a real cost and quality problem in production AI agents. Generic web search tools return broad, unstructured results that force agents to process irrelevant pages and make redundant tool calls—a pattern that burns tokens and slows inference. By learning domain-specific requirements and tuning retrieval strategies to match the task, Nimble's harness reduces both the token overhead and the post-processing burden on engineering teams. The benchmark results—51% fewer tokens and a 21-point quality gain—suggest the approach works at scale; Rox's reported 20-fold token reduction after adoption indicates the gains are not theoretical.

The timing reflects a maturing market concern. As enterprises deploy AI agents for business-critical research (market research, lead enrichment, competitive intelligence), cost and accuracy have become the bottleneck, not speed. Nimble explicitly targets teams running agents that operate for hours, where a missed source has higher cost than a slower answer. The company's positioning—specialized agents for specialized tasks—also maps to feedback from customers like Qodo, whose teams value the ability to tune agents to surface only relevant signals rather than generic summaries.
